
The good:
Toned-down exterior styling; simplified iDrive interface; adaptive headlights and pressure-sensitive taillights; valve-controlled throttle.
The bad:
Limited Bluetooth phone compatibility; pricey; run-flat wheels make for a bumpy ride.
The bottom line:
Very little bad can be said about the BMW 330i. Its first-rate technology contributes to performance, comfort, and safety.
